It was always a gamble but the organization's heralding of JW org and lit carts has had the unintended consequence of taking even more wind out of the already flagging door-to-door work. I see a couple of older JWs every several months or so out and about door-knocking but never any younger ones - not for years.

    Contrast that to the late 1960s and early to mid-1970s when carloads of us young born-ins would descend upon the territory and householders would sigh and declare, "You people were doing this street less than a month ago!" And, yes, here we were covering the same over-worked territory several times a year.

    That simpky does not happen anymore - at least in New Zealand.
